&lt;p class="MsoNormal" align="center" style="text-align: center; tab-stops: 210.0pt;"&gt;&lt;b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al;"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 14.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;Biography of Gentleman He &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Xueyun&lt;/span&gt;&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;&lt;o:p&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 36.0pt;"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;The surname of the gentleman was He, first name &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Yuanqi&lt;/span&gt;, and courtesy name &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Youren&lt;/span&gt;. In his later years, he used &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Xueyun&lt;/span&gt; [Plowing in the Snow] as his style name. He was from &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Guodong&lt;/span&gt; Hamlet in &l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:place&gt;&lt;st1:placename&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;South&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placename&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:placetype&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;Township&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placetype&gt;&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; in our county [&l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:place&gt;&lt;st1:placename&gt;&l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;Wuyi&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placename&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:placetype&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;County&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placetype&gt;&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;]. &lt;span class="GramE"&gt;The He&lt;/span&gt; lineage is a famous lineage in our county. There have been famous figures in every generation since the Song (960-1276) and Yuan (1276-1368) &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;ontothe&lt;/span&gt; Ming Dynasty (1368-1644). The Gentleman was able to maintain the values of his lineage. Among those in our &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;hamletknown&lt;/span&gt; &lt;span class="GramE"&gt;for &l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;knowledge&lt;/span&gt; of the Classics and refinement of conduct, all agreed that Gentleman was the best.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 36.0pt;"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;The Gentleman’s father, the Gentleman [He] &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Fanghan&lt;/span&gt;, passed away when he was only three years old. If it were not for his mother the Lady Tang’s sedulous rearing, he would not have been able to establish himself. As soon as he could speak, she taught him to read books by lamplight. During moments &lt;span class="GramE"&gt;of &l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;leisure&lt;/span&gt;, she would discuss ancient principles and politics with him; he could understand it all, and followed her instructions carefully. He was brilliant, and was diligent in study. Once he went to school his learning became ever more &lt;span class="GramE"&gt;refined &l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;and&lt;/span&gt; his accomplishment more profound. His writings often surprised the elders. He went to the county school when he was young, and soon became a Government Student.&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n1;" href="#_ftn1" name="_ftnref1"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 12.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[1]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;When the education officials examined the students, he always ranked in the top group. When he participated in the Provincial Examination, as soon as his examination essay became public, his friends were surprised and admiring. The discerning said that his essays were in the style of the &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Jiajing&lt;/span&gt; (1522-1566) and &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Longqing&lt;/span&gt; (1567-1572) reign periods of the former Ming dynasty&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n2;" href="#_ftn2" name="_ftnref2"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 12.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[2]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;and could serve as the model for the literati.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 36.0pt;"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;His ability did not match his fate. He participated in the civil service examinations ten times, but no matter how many times he participated in he failed. After [the county] nominated him to the &l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:place&gt;&lt;st1:placename&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;National&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placename&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:placetype&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;University&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placetype&gt;&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n3;" href="#_ftn3" name="_ftnref3"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 12.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[3]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;. &lt;span class="GramE"&gt;he&lt;/span&gt; gave up taking examinations. His mother had already died by this time. He thought that since he no longer needed to “support [his mother] by holding the summons,”&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n4;" href="#_ftn4" name="_ftnref4"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 12.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[4]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;passing the examinations was not worth the honor.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 36.0pt;"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;His ancestors had already acquired a rich collection of books. The Gentleman kept on buying books that the collection lacked, so that it continued to grow. Day and night, eating and sleeping, he was &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;in the library&lt;span class="GramE"&gt;,&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;a&lt;/span&gt; book always in his hand. He read through them all, from the Classics and histories, to the hundred philosophers and unofficial records, to the modern collections of poetry and prose, and he could remember all he read. When young students had questions, re responded without any difficulty&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;,&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;analyzing the issue from beginning to end in &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;detail. Besides composition in the&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; examination format,&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n5;" href="#_ftn5" name="_ftnref5"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 12.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[5]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;he was especially fond of ancient-style prose. However, he never composed &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;anythin&lt;/span&gt; perfunctorily&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;W&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;hen composed a piece, it achieved superiority. His writings were like unadorned jade and undecorated gold, one would know they were precious treasures at the first glance.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-tab-count: 1;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;At home he was famous of his filial piety and &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;fraternality&lt;/span&gt;. He loved doing good deeds. He administered the affairs of the ancestral hall and established a community school; he built forts, and renovated bridges. He did not begrudge the enormous &lt;span class="GramE"&gt;expense,&lt;/span&gt; he was only concerned with getting it done.&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;When among the neighbors and relatives there those who were poor and suffering, he would&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; help&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t; them without being stingy. His family was wealthy but gradually it ran short of money. Yet whenever there was good to be done, he supported it without hesitation even if it bankrupted him. It must have been his nature.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oNormal"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-tab-count: 1;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;He lost several wives. His first wife was [surnamed] Zhu, the second &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Xu&lt;/span&gt;, and the third Tang. All were virtuous and pure. &lt;span class="GramE"&gt;He&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;was&lt;/span&gt; past forty years old before he had his two sons. The first, &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Yingmeng&lt;/span&gt;, was a &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;National University &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;Student.&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n6;" href="#_ftn6" name="_ftnref6"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 12.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[6]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;The second, &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Yinghao&lt;/span&gt;, was a&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; Tribute Student.&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n7;" href="#_ftn7" name="_ftnref7"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 12.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[7]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;When [&l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Yinghao&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span class="GramE"&gt;]was&lt;/span&gt; a&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Prefectural&lt;/span&gt; Graduate&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;, he &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;participated in&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t; the&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; provincial examinations &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;in the same year as &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;I&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;, and we associated with each other through writing. In his youth he was scholarly and gained literary fame. At the time he was expected to go far, but he died in the middle age, and ended up only as a&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; Classicist.&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n8;" href="#_ftn8" name="_ftnref8"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 12.0pt; font-family: Arial; m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[8]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;People felt sorry for him and sad for his father.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 21.0pt;"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-family: Arial;"&gt;Today, because they are recompiling the genealogy, his grandson has asked me to write his biography for the family history, in accord with his father’s will. Now those who do not receive just reward in their own lifetimes will certainly see it received by their descendants. Since the Gentleman had accumulated so &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;muchvirtue&lt;/span&gt; and in addition to the richness of his book collection, we sincerely that his descendants to study and cultivate themselves, and thus to achieve fame and succeed in their work.&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;

&lt;div style="mso-element: footnote-list;"&gt;&lt;br clear="all" /&gt;&lt;hr align="left" size="1" width="33%" /&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n1;" href="#_ftnref1" name="_ftn1"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: 'Times New Roman';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[1]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;Government Students were those students in government schools who received stipends and were eligible to &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;to&lt;/span&gt; participate in the Provincial Examinations.&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&#13;
&lt;div style="mso-element: footnote;" id="ftn2"&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oFootnoteText"&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n2;" href="#_ftnref2" name="_ftn2"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: 'Times New Roman';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[2]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&amp;nbsp;During the &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;Jiajing&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; and &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Longqing&lt;/span&gt; reign periods (1522-1572)&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;some literati advocated for returning to ancient style in literature to redress what they what they saw as the decline in contemporary literature They took as their model the succinct, &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;undecorative&lt;/span&gt;, and powerful prose from &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Qin&lt;/span&gt; and Han (221 BC-220 AD) times.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;/div&gt;&#13;
&lt;div style="mso-element: footnote;" id="ftn3"&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oFootnoteText"&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n3;" href="#_ftnref3" name="_ftn3"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: 'Times New Roman';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[3]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&amp;nbsp;He thus gained formal status as a “Tribute Student” this made him eligible to participate in the Metropolitan Examination and, in principle, eligible for a low ranking post.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;/div&gt;&#13;
&lt;div style="mso-element: footnote;" id="ftn4"&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oFootnoteText"&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n4;" href="#_ftnref4" name="_ftn4"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: 'Times New Roman';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[4]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;span class="GramE"&gt;An allusion to &lt;span style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;Mao Yi of the Eastern Han (25-220) who was famous for his filial piety.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; One day, when his friend Zhang &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Feng&lt;/span&gt; was visiting, a summons arrived appointing Mao to a governmental position. Mao was delighted but Liu &lt;/span&gt;&lt;st2:citation&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;{&l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;dor&lt;/span&gt; you mean Zhang}&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st2:citation&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; despised him for what he took to be his delight in leaving home to advance himself. Later, when Mao’s mother died, he quit government service. Only then did Liu/Zhang understand that Mao had only served in government to support his mother. &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;/div&gt;&#13;
&lt;div style="mso-element: footnote;" id="ftn5"&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oFootnoteText"&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n5;" href="#_ftnref5" name="_ftn5"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: 'Times New Roman';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[5]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&amp;nbsp;The required format at the time was known as the “e&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;ight-legged &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;essay.”Here&lt;/span&gt; “leg” refers to the creation of parallelisms in writing. The typical examination essay discussed the core idea in an assigned passage from the Four Books. In addition &lt;span class="GramE"&gt;to&lt;span style="mso-spacerun: yes;"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;creating&lt;/span&gt; an elaborate parallel structure and the writer was expected to write from the perspective of the sage or worthy who had authored the passage. For a discussion of this form see Ching-I Tu, “The Chinese Examination Essay: Some Literary Considerations,” in &lt;u&gt;Monumenta Serica&lt;/u&gt;, 31 (1974-74).&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;/div&gt;&#13;
&lt;div style="mso-element: footnote;" id="ftn6"&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oFootnoteText"&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n6;" href="#_ftnref6" name="_ftn6"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: 'Times New Roman';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[6]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&amp;nbsp;There were various kinds of National University Students including both Tribute Students, recommended by the county school (such as He &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Yuanqi&lt;/span&gt; himself and his second son), and students who had purchased this status. Perhaps the lack of clarity in He &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;Yingmeng’s&lt;/span&gt; case means &lt;span class="SpellE"&gt;hehad&lt;/span&gt; the status by purchase.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;/div&gt;&#13;
&lt;div style="mso-element: footnote;" id="ftn7"&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oFootnoteText"&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n7;" href="#_ftnref7" name="_ftn7"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: 'Times New Roman';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[7]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;Tribute students were the students annually promoted into the &l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:place&gt;&lt;st1:placename&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;National&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placename&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:placetype&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;University&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placetype&gt;&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; at the dynastic capital from local schools through out the empire.&l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&lt;/div&gt;&#13;
&lt;div style="mso-element: footnote;" id="ftn8"&gt;&#13;
&lt;p class="MsoFootnoteText"&gt;&lt;a style="mso-footnote-id: ftn8;" href="#_ftnref8" name="_ftn8" title=""&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&lt;span style="mso-special-character: footnote;"&gt;&lt;span class="MsoFootnoteReference"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="font-size: 10.0pt; font-family: 'Times New Roman'; mso-fareast-font-family: SimSun; mso-ansi-language: EN-US; mso-fareast-language: ZH-CN; mso-bidi-language: AR-SA;"&gt;[8]&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span class="GramE"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;Referring to those &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:place&gt;&lt;st1:placename&gt;&lt;span class="GramE"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;National&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placename&gt;&lt;span class="GramE"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;st1:placetype&gt;&lt;span class="GramE"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t;University&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/st1:placetype&gt;&lt;/st1:place&gt;&lt;span class="GramE"&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; students with formal status as Tribute Students.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span lang="EN-US" style="mso-fareast-font-family: 新細明體; mso-fareast-language: ZH-TW;"&gt; &lt;o:p&gt;&lt;/o:p&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
